Преимущества использования CSS в веб-программировании



CSS, или каскадные таблицы стилей, является важным инструментом в веб-программировании. Этот язык позволяет разработчикам веб-сайтов определять стиль и внешний вид веб-страниц, делая их более привлекательными и удобными для пользователей. Преимущества использования CSS огромны и важны для создания современных и профессиональных веб-сайтов.

Одно из главных преимуществ CSS — это отделение стиля от содержимого. То есть, CSS позволяет разделить техническую сторону веб-сайта от его внешнего оформления. Это значит, что вся стилизация веб-страниц может происходить в одном файле CSS, который можно легко изменять и обновлять без изменения кода самой страницы. Это упрощает поддержку и управление веб-сайтом, поскольку изменения стилей можно вносить всего лишь в нескольких строках кода.

Еще одно преимущество CSS — это возможность создания структурированного и гибкого дизайна веб-страниц. С помощью CSS разработчики могут устанавливать размеры, расположение и выравнивание элементов на веб-странице. Кроме того, CSS позволяет легко создавать адаптивный дизайн, который автоматически подстраивается под различные типы устройств и экранов. Благодаря этому, веб-сайты, созданные с использованием CSS, могут легко адаптироваться для работы на мобильных устройствах, планшетах и компьютерах.

Преимущества CSS в веб-программировании

1. Разделение структуры и оформления: С помощью CSS можно легко отделить структуру HTML документа от его оформления. Это позволяет создавать более гибкий и модульный код, который легче поддерживать и изменять.

2. Улучшение доступности: CSS позволяет легко изменять представление веб-страницы для различных устройств и пользователей. Можно создавать адаптивные и мобильные версии сайта, учитывая особенности разных устройств и индивидуальные настройки пользователей.

3. Улучшение производительности: Использование отдельного файла CSS позволяет браузерам кэшировать стили и повторно использовать их на других страницах вашего сайта. Это сокращает количество передаваемых данных и снижает время загрузки страницы.

4. Большая гибкость и контроль: CSS предоставляет множество возможностей для создания разнообразных эффектов и макетов. Вы можете легко управлять шрифтами, цветами, расположением элементов и многим другим, что позволяет создавать уникальный и привлекательный дизайн.

5. Легкость использования: CSS имеет простое и интуитивно понятное синтаксическое правило. Вам не нужно запоминать большое количество тегов и атрибутов, так как CSS позволяет использовать классы и идентификаторы для применения стилей к нескольким элементам.

6. Более высокая переносимость: CSS поддерживается всеми современными браузерами и платформами. Вы можете создавать один набор стилей, который будет работать на разных операционных системах и устройствах.

7. Легкость поддержки и обновления: Размещение всех стилей в отдельном файле CSS упрощает их обновление и сопровождение. Вам не придется изменять каждую страницу в случае изменения дизайна или добавления новых элементов.

В результате, использование CSS дает разработчикам больше контроля над оформлением и представлением веб-страниц, улучшает производительность и доступность, а также облегчает поддержку и развитие проекта.

Более гибкий и удобный дизайн

С помощью CSS можно легко изменить цвет, шрифт, размер текста, а также добавить различные эффекты и анимации. Это особенно полезно, когда требуется внести изменения во всем сайте или во всем разделе. Также CSS позволяет создавать множество стилей и легко переключаться между ними, что упрощает поддержку и разработку сайта.

Еще одним преимуществом CSS является возможность создания мобильной версии сайта или адаптивного дизайна. С помощью медиа-запросов и других CSS-свойств можно настроить отображение сайта на различных устройствах и экранах, оптимизируя пользовательский опыт и удобство использования сайта на смартфонах и планшетах.

Кроме того, использование CSS позволяет разделять структуру и стиль веб-сайта, что делает его код более читаемым и понятным для разработчиков. Это значительно упрощает сопровождение и внесение изменений в код, а также повышает его переиспользуемость.

Преимущества CSS в веб-программировании:
Легкое изменение внешнего вида и стиля сайта
Возможность создания мобильной версии сайта или адаптивного дизайна
Разделение структуры и стиля веб-сайта

Экономия времени и ресурсов

Использование CSS в веб-программировании предоставляет множество преимуществ, включая экономию времени и ресурсов. Благодаря CSS, разработчику не нужно повторять одни и те же стили для каждого элемента в документе. Вместо этого, он может определить стили один раз и применить их ко всем элементам, которым нужны эти стили.

Это значительно сокращает объем кода и упрощает его поддержку и обновление. Кроме того, CSS позволяет создавать отдельные файлы со стилями, которые можно подключать к нескольким веб-страницам одновременно. Это позволяет избежать дублирования кода и упрощает дизайн и разработку сайта в целом.

Кроме того, использование CSS позволяет легко изменять внешний вид веб-страницы без необходимости внесения изменений в HTML-код. Это означает, что можно легко менять цвета, шрифты, размеры и другие аспекты дизайна без необходимости копировать и вставлять код повторно.

Также стоит отметить, что использование CSS позволяет создать адаптивный дизайн, который автоматически адаптируется под различные устройства и экраны. Это упрощает разработку мобильных версий сайтов и повышает их удобство использования для пользователей на разных устройствах.

В целом, использование CSS является эффективным способом экономии времени и ресурсов при разработке веб-проектов. Оно позволяет улучшить производительность работы, сократить объем кода, упростить его поддержку и обновление, а также создать более гибкий и удобный веб-дизайн.

Легкость обновления и изменения стилей

Использование CSS в веб-программировании предоставляет значительные преимущества в легкости обновления и изменения стилей веб-страницы. Вместо того, чтобы вручную изменять каждое отдельное место, где применяется стиль, мы можем легко изменить его один раз, и эти изменения автоматически применятся ко всем соответствующим элементам на веб-странице.

Это значит, что если, к примеру, мы хотим изменить цвет фона для всех заголовков на нашей странице, нам нужно будет изменить всего лишь одну строку в файле CSS, а не искать и изменять каждый отдельный заголовок на всех страницах сайта. Это значительно сокращает затраты времени и усилий при обновлении внешнего вида сайта.

Кроме того, при использовании CSS мы можем воспользоваться такими функциями, как наследование стилей, что позволяет нам создавать общие стили, которые применяются к нескольким элементам одновременно. Если мы решим изменить такой общий стиль, эти изменения автоматически применятся ко всем связанным элементам на всех страницах сайта.

Таким образом, благодаря легкости обновления и изменения стилей, использование CSS позволяет нам значительно экономить время и ресурсы при разработке и поддержке веб-сайтов.

Улучшение скорости загрузки страниц

Использование CSS позволяет значительно ускорить загрузку страницы. CSS-файл может быть загружен один раз и переиспользован для всех страниц вашего веб-сайта. Это сокращает объем передаваемых данных с сервера на клиентскую сторону и уменьшает время загрузки страницы.

Кроме того, CSS позволяет разделить структуру и визуальное оформление вашего сайта. Вместо использования inline-стилей или повторного описания стилей на каждой странице, вы можете определить стили в одном месте — в CSS-файле. Это упрощает поддержку и обновление дизайна вашего сайта.

Дополнительно, CSS позволяет использовать сжатие файлов. Вы можете сжать ваш CSS-код с помощью инструментов сжатия, которые удалат все неиспользуемые пробелы, отступы и комментарии. Сжатие CSS-файла приводит к уменьшению его размера и ускорению его загрузки на веб-страницу.

Возможность создания адаптивного дизайна

С помощью CSS можно задавать различные стили для разных размеров экранов или групп устройств. Например, можно создать стили, которые будут отображаться только на мобильных устройствах или только на планшетах. Это позволяет оптимизировать пользовательский интерфейс и предоставить пользователям более удобный доступ к информации на любом устройстве.

Для создания адаптивного дизайна также можно использовать медиа-запросы, которые позволяют применять различные стили в зависимости от размеров экрана. Например, можно задать определенные стили для экранов с шириной менее 500 пикселей или для экранов с разрешением выше Full HD.

Важным аспектом адаптивного дизайна является также резиновая верстка. С помощью CSS можно задавать относительные единицы измерения, такие как проценты или em, что позволяет элементам страницы приспосабливаться к размерам экрана и масштабироваться соответственно.

Преимущества использования CSS в веб-программировании:
Удобство использования и поддержка стандартов
Разделение структуры и визуального оформления
Возможность создания адаптивного дизайна

Улучшение доступности и SEO-оптимизация

Применение CSS в веб-программировании имеет множество преимуществ, включая улучшение доступности и SEO-оптимизацию.

CSS позволяет разработчикам создавать гибкие и адаптивные веб-страницы, которые можно легко читать и навигировать для людей с ограниченными возможностями. При использовании CSS можно, например, создавать стилизованные кнопки с контрастными цветами, что улучшает наглядность и позволяет людям с проблемами зрения легче взаимодействовать с веб-страницей.

CSS также позволяет легко оптимизировать веб-страницы для поисковых систем. Разделение структуры и оформления позволяет поисковым роботам эффективно проходить по коду веб-страницы и понимать ее структуру. Это позволяет поисковым системам точнее определить содержание веб-страницы и показывать его в результатах поиска, что улучшает SEO-оптимизацию и помогает привлекать больше посетителей на сайт.

Другим способом использования CSS для улучшения доступности и SEO-оптимизации — это создание адаптивного дизайна. Адаптивный дизайн позволяет веб-страницам автоматически подстраиваться под разные размеры экранов устройств, таких как мобильные телефоны и планшеты. Это улучшает доступность, поскольку позволяет пользователям комфортно просматривать содержимое веб-страницы на разных устройствах. Кроме того, адаптивный дизайн также положительно влияет на SEO, поскольку поисковые системы все больше учитывают мобильность сайта при определении ранжирования в поисковых запросах.

  • Улучшение доступности.
  • SEO-оптимизация через разделение структуры и оформления.
  • Адаптивный дизайн для улучшения доступности и SEO-оптимизации.

Возможность повторного использования стилей

Как только стиль определен в CSS, его можно применять ко всем элементам, отрисованным на веб-странице. Это особенно полезно при создании больших и сложных сайтов, где нужно задавать единый и последовательный внешний вид для разных элементов. Благодаря возможности повторного использования стилей, можно значительно сократить объем кода и упростить его поддержку и обновление в будущем.

Кроме того, использование повторяемых стилей помогает сохранять структуру HTML-файла более читаемой и понятной, так как все стили объединены в отдельный файл CSS. Это позволяет разработчикам и дизайнерам легко найти и изменить нужные стили без необходимости просмотра всего HTML-кода страницы.

Таким образом, благодаря возможности повторного использования стилей в CSS, разработчики получают более гибкий, эффективный и удобочитаемый способ создания и редактирования дизайна веб-страницы.

Добавить комментарий

Вам также может понравиться